Transaction 8896e80485cc6802885019fab3176f307ebf6d5455a210cc8e8ae038dc1cc5f5
1 Input
1 Output
-
8896e80485cc6802885019fab3176f307ebf6d5455a210cc8e8ae038dc1cc5f5:0
- value
- 557682
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c0fdd3d8160459a3d51cf1c1c029351c46a6fa2e OP_EQUAL
- address
- 3KHTjcvZgBvweiytBh6XBJ2g4iqbGiwJFw